Is Chanel a French Brand?

Yes, CHANEL is a quintessentially French brand, known for its Parisian chic and classic designs. The brand was founded in Paris by Gabrielle Chanel, a pioneering fashion designer who revolutionized the industry with her innovative approach to style and design.

Is Chanel French or Italian?

While the House of CHANEL is undeniably French, there is a common misconception that the founder, Coco Chanel, had Italian roots. However, Coco Chanel was born in Saumur, France, in 1883, and spent much of her life in Paris, where she established her fashion empire.

Coco Chanel's Early Fashion Designs

Coco Chanel's early fashion designs were groundbreaking in their simplicity and elegance. She was known for her use of luxurious fabrics, clean lines, and understated silhouettes, which revolutionized women's fashion in the early 20th century. Chanel's iconic designs, such as the little black dress, the Chanel suit, and the quilted handbag, have become timeless classics that continue to influence designers to this day.

Gabrielle "Coco" Chanel

Gabrielle "Coco" Chanel was a visionary fashion designer who revolutionized the industry with her modern approach to style and design. Born in France in 1883, Chanel overcame a tumultuous childhood to become one of the most influential figures in fashion history. Her brand, CHANEL, continues to embody her spirit of independence, creativity, and elegance.
